I'm sure I'm dating myself with the post, as it's been several months since I'd been to the Shakopee Wal-Mart, but I sure was in for a happy surprise when I stopped there last week for an eye exam. Aunt Annie's has replaced what used to be a McDonald's. Hurrah!! I LUV their pretzels and the only other places they sell them at in the Twin Cities are malls (including the Eden Prairie Center).
I was chatting with an employee at Wal-Mart about it, and she agreed Aunt Annie's is great for customers, but said employees have missed the larger array of food they could get from McDonald's during their breaks. However, in addition to Aunt Annie's pretzels, they are also selling smoothies and sandwich wraps there. I ordered a berry smoothie, I believe, which was good, but overpriced. (Wouldn't have purchased it if I would have known it would be $5.)
According to its Web site, Aunt Annie's is also at three other Wal-Marts in the state: Red Wing, Cambridge and Buffalo.
This must be a great boon for Wal-Mart. I know I, for one, will be stopping there now just because I have a craving for a soft yummy pretzel.
